Output 7661ca3b9319facc52c6c179fe53340e831a3c5c230ca3495f597a8d6b60fd73:0

value
3653000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a260bfe1f98f80e503daedc386998b659e42f9 OP_EQUAL
address
3CsStARYhAB8i825DbawguoFwJR3xBRCAz
transaction
7661ca3b9319facc52c6c179fe53340e831a3c5c230ca3495f597a8d6b60fd73
spent
true